Incident Summary:

01/08/2014: Assailants attacked Kayamula village in Konduga local government area, Borno state, Nigeria. At least nine people were killed and several others were injured. Additionally, witnesses reported that the assailants had suffered a number of casualties. No group claimed responsibility for the violence; however, sources attributed the incident to Boko Haram.
